In response to the crucial demand for safe lithium-ion battery storage and charging, Justrite has launched its cutting-edge Lithium-Ion Battery Charging Cabinet. This cutting-edge cabinet uses the unique 9-Layer ChargeGuard Containment System to minimize catastrophic losses from battery fires and thermal runaway.

The 9-Layer ChargeGuard Containment System is built of double-wall welded steel, vented door panels, and reinforced steel door latch plates to withstand explosions and keep the enclosure safe. It also has double-layer wire-mesh flame arrestors, an insulating air gap, and door hinge flame guards to keep heat and flames within.

It also includes spring-loaded dampers, a unique filtration system, and heat-activated expanding door seals to control the escape of harmful smoke and gasses. The crossflow fan ventilation keeps the cabinet cool, and its practical benchtop form, lockable doors, and small footprint make it a useful addition to any workspace.

The cabinet weighs 157 pounds and has dimensions of 24″ H by 43″ W by 18″ L. It has eight charging ports and runs on 120VAC/60Hz. With a Total Energy Containment Rating (TECR) of 2kWh, capacity fluctuates depending on battery energy levels.

Lithium-ion batteries, which are widely employed in modern technology, represent a major fire risk, as proven by the over 5,000 battery fire incidents documented each year. These batteries can be extremely explosive, emitting highly poisonous vapors and notoriously difficult to extinguish once ignited. The technology built into Justrite’s Lithium-Ion Battery Charging Cabinet is specifically designed to address and mitigate such risks by preventing fires and explosions while charging and storage.
